One such abandoned https://nezeh.com">https://nacnoc.com">Hotel is the iconic Wellington Hotel in Ooty, a hill station known for its picturesque landscapes and colonial charm. Built in the late 19th century, the Wellington Hotel was a luxury retreat for British colonial officers and wealthy travelers. However, due to changing trends in tourism and neglect over the years, the hotel now stands empty and forlorn, its faded grandeur hinting at a bygone era. Further south, in the coastal town of Mahabalipuram, lies another abandoned hotel that once catered to tourists seeking sun, sand, and sea. The Sea Breeze Hotel, with its stunning views of the Bay of Bengal, was a popular destination in the 1980s. However, mismanagement and financial troubles led to its closure, and the hotel now sits as a silent witness to its former glory.
